What is a CPU?
A CPU, or Central Processing Unit, is the main component of a computer that carries out the instructions of a computer program by performing basic arithmetic, logical, control, and input/output (I/O) operations
A CPU, or Central Processing Unit, is the main component of a computer that carries out the instructions of a computer program by performing basic arithmetic, logical, control, and input/output (I/O) operations. Also known as the processor, it is often referred to as the “brain” of the computer.
The CPU is responsible for executing instructions that are stored in the computer’s memory, including both the operating system and application software. It fetches instructions from memory, decodes them to understand what needs to be done, and then executes them by performing calculations or accessing other hardware components.
The CPU consists of several key components, including:
1. Control Unit (CU): This component coordinates and controls the operations of the CPU. It fetches instructions from memory, interprets them, and directs the appropriate data to be processed.
2. Arithmetic Logic Unit (ALU): The ALU performs arithmetic operations such as addition, subtraction, multiplication, and division, as well as logical operations like comparisons and bitwise operations.
3. Registers: These are small, high-speed memory units located within the CPU. Registers store data, instructions, and addresses that the CPU needs to perform its operations quickly.
4. Cache: Cache is a small and fast memory located on the CPU itself. It stores frequently accessed data and instructions to speed up processing time, as accessing data from the cache is faster than accessing it from the main memory.
5. Clock: The CPU is synchronized by a clock signal, which determines the speed at which instructions are executed. The frequency of the clock is measured in Hertz (Hz), indicating the number of cycles per second.
Modern CPUs come with multiple cores, each capable of executing instructions independently. This allows for parallel processing, enabling the CPU to handle multiple tasks simultaneously, improving overall performance.
In summary, the CPU is a crucial component of a computer that carries out instructions by performing various operations. Its components work together to execute instructions, perform calculations, and manage the overall functioning of the computer system.
More Answers:
The Importance and Functions of Operating Systems: A Comprehensive GuideExploring the Features and Benefits of Distributed Operating Systems in Science
Optimizing CPU Performance: Strategies and Solutions for CPU-Bound Scenarios